(Salt Lake City, UT) – A former Utah County commissioner could avoid jail time by pleading guilty to one count of communication fraud. Gary Jay Anderson entered his plea yesterday in a deal that saw three other counts against him dropped. Anderson admitted to defrauding investors in a scheme where he and a partner impersonated leaders of the Mormon Church. Prosecutors say the 70-year-old can avoid going to jail if he repays 25-thousand-dollars in restitution by his sentencing in August.Â
